Honestly, it felt like I was throwing spaghetti at the wall. Here’s the shortcut I wish someone gave me: Pick one business workflow, just one, and rebuild it with AI. That’s it. For example, take appointment booking. Instead of trying to learn 10 tools at once, focus on this flow: 1. Capture lead → 2. Store details in a Google Sheet or Notion → 3. Trigger an AI message (email/WhatsApp) → 4. Confirm the booking in a calendar. Once you pull that off, two things happen: - You’ll actually understand how APIs, triggers, and agents fit together. - You’ll have something you can show a business and say, “Look, this is working right now.” That’s way more valuable than being a “jack of all prompts.” So here’s my question for you: if you had to pick one business workflow to automate today, what would it be?
